Arpex will be equipped with a leepod. The leepod is an extrusion of the hull out to the oposite side of the ama. The idea is, that the leepod creates buoyancy at a certain degree of heel. As such, it would oppose the heeling moment, and prevent capsize. At least under certain conditions. Its use is controversial.
I've built the boat model to test the functionality. The videos (posted here before - see archives) have showed me that the leepod does prevent capsize to a certain degree, and help reerect the boat if capsize occurs. Additional to the buoyancy effect, I have observed that when the leepod slams the water, a dynamic lift effect also adds to the stability effect. The angle of the front panel, between hullside and the extrusion, is key to that effect.
One negative aspect of the leepod is that it obstructs when going alongside a jetty. Since I don't plan for that, I don't care.
This illustration is for a shunting proa. It shows the proa form underneath, and the leepod is nicely seen. An additional benefit of the leepod is that it creates valuable roomspace in anotherwise very narrow hullform. It fits a double bed quite nicely.Another element of stability will be water ballast tanks in the ama. I still have to work out how they will be operated. Handpumps and eletrical pumps are easy to find. Not too cheap, but the double system will be quite reliable.
